  11. Just to put some light on this subject, Jim Hannah was told that NO MATTER how good it was in England and Scotland the doos could not be liberated because its tipping it down at Carentan. Before anyone says we should have moved them, it wouldn't have made any difference because they could only have been moved on the same line of flight as Carentan, in other words staying West as was voted for by Members at the AGM. Like everyone else I'm frustrated by them not getting up but i don't want them flung up either.
